FCC Statement (For U.S.A. Only)
Federal Communications Commission Radio Frequency Interfer-
ence Statement
Warning:
This equipment generates, uses, and can radiate radio frequency energy. If it
is not installed and used in accordance with the instruction manual, it may cause interfer-
ence to radio communications. It has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a
Class A computing device pursuant to Part 15 of FCC Rules, which are designed to provide
reasonable protection against such interference when operated in a commercial environ-
ment. Operation of this equipment in a residential area is likely to cause interference, in
which case the user at his own expense will be required to take whatever measures may be
required to correct the interference.
If this equipment causes interference to radio reception (which can be determined by un-
plugging the power cord from the equipment) try these measures: Re-orient the receiving
antenna. Relocate the equipment with respect to the receiver. Plug the equipment and re-
ceiver into different branch circuits. Consult your dealer or an experienced technician for
additional suggestions.
